EDMONTON, Alberta (AP) The Chicago Blackhawks are sticking to their plan of becoming a better road team.
Jonathan Toews scored two goals and added an assist as the Blackhawks won their sixth game in a row, knocking off the Edmonton Oilers 5-2 on Saturday night.
Patrick Kane, Kris Versteeg and John Madden also scored for the Blackhawks (14-5-2), who built on a 7-1 win over Calgary for their second consecutive road win at the start of a six-game trip - their longest of the season.
